Who controlled the land west of the Mississippi River during the American Revolution?

Spain. The western part of French Louisiana was turned over to the Spanish in 1763 following the Seven Years' War.

During the American Revolution, the land west of the Mississippi River was controlled by Spain, which expanded its territory in 1763. Spain's control included the crucial Mississippi River, leading to trade challenges for American settlers. The situation changed with the U.S. Louisiana Purchase in 1803, which substantially increased U.S. territory.
